Analyte Flux at a Biomaterial–Tissue Interface over Time: Implications for Sensors for Type 1 and 2 Diabetes Mellitus

OBJECTIVE: The very presence of an implanted sensor (a foreign body) causes changes in the adjacent tissue that may alter the analytes being sensed.
